A Glimpse into Obsidian Entertainment
Founded in 2003, Obsidian Entertainment has built a reputation for producing engaging role-playing games (RPGs). The studio’s commitment to storytelling, player choice, and innovation has made it a favorite among gamers worldwide. Acquired by Xbox Game Studios in 2018, Obsidian now operates under Microsoft’s banner, opening up even more possibilities for growth and creativity.

Job Roles at Obsidian Entertainment
Obsidian Entertainment offers a range of career opportunities across various disciplines. Below is a detailed breakdown of the key roles available:
Job Title | Department | Core Responsibilities |
---|---|---|
Game Designer | Design | Develop gameplay mechanics, systems, and narratives. |
Programmer | Engineering | Write and maintain code for game features and tools. |
Artist (3D/Concept) | Art | Create visual assets such as characters, environments, etc. |
Animator | Animation | Design and implement character and object animations. |
QA Tester | Quality Assurance | Test games for bugs, usability, and performance issues. |
Producer | Production | Manage schedules, resources, and team communication. |
Sound Designer | Audio | Craft audio effects and integrate them into the game. |
Marketing Specialist | Marketing | Promote games through campaigns and social media. |

Game Designer
Game designers at Obsidian are responsible for shaping the player’s journey. From crafting intricate questlines to balancing combat mechanics, this role demands creativity and analytical thinking.
Key Skills:
- Proficiency in game design tools like Unreal Engine or Unity.
- Strong storytelling and scripting abilities.
- Collaboration with other departments.
Programmer
Programmers bring the game to life by developing its underlying code. Whether it’s AI behavior or user interface functionality, their work ensures a seamless gaming experience.
Key Skills:
- Expertise in C++ or C#.
- Problem-solving and debugging skills.
- Knowledge of game engines and optimization techniques.
Artist
Artists create the visual identity of Obsidian’s games. From sketching initial concepts to rendering 3D models, their work adds depth and personality to the game world.
Key Skills:
- Proficiency in software like Maya, Blender, or Photoshop.
- Understanding of color theory, anatomy, and perspective.
- Attention to detail and ability to meet deadlines.
Quality Assurance Tester
QA testers are the unsung heroes who ensure the final product meets the highest standards. They identify glitches, test gameplay, and provide valuable feedback.
Key Skills:
- Eye for detail.
- Strong communication skills to report issues clearly.
- Familiarity with testing tools and documentation.
